数据库符号用圆表示是因为圆形符号能够直观地代表数据的存储和处理、历史传统的延续、易于理解和识别。其中,圆形符号能够直观地代表数据的存储和处理这一点尤为重要。在数据库设计中,圆形符号常被用来表示数据存储位置,如表、记录和字段。圆形的形状使人联想到封闭和完整的数据存储空间,便于理解数据之间的关联和关系。例如,在实体-关系图(ER图)中,圆形符号直观地表示了不同实体之间的关系,使设计师和开发者能够更轻松地理解和操作数据。
一、数据库符号的历史背景
数据库符号的使用可以追溯到数据库管理系统(DBMS)和关系数据库理论的早期发展阶段。1970年代,埃德加·科德(Edgar F. Codd)提出了关系数据库模型,极大地推动了数据库技术的发展。在这一时期,数据库设计师和工程师们需要一种直观易懂的方式来表示数据结构和关系。圆形符号因为其简单、直观的特性,被广泛采用,成为数据库设计图中的标准符号之一。
二、圆形符号的直观性和易理解性
在数据库设计中,直观性和易理解性是至关重要的。圆形符号以其简洁的形态,能够有效地传达数据的存储和处理信息。圆形的形状没有方向性和尖锐的边角,使其看起来更加友好和易于理解。设计师和用户可以通过圆形符号快速识别数据存储位置和数据之间的关系,从而提高数据库设计和操作的效率。
三、圆形符号在实体-关系图(ER图)中的应用
实体-关系图(ER图)是数据库设计中常用的工具之一,用于表示实体、属性和实体之间的关系。在ER图中,圆形符号常用于表示实体的属性。属性是描述实体特征的数据,如用户的姓名、年龄、地址等。将属性用圆形符号表示,可以直观地展示属性与实体之间的关联关系,使设计图更加清晰易读。此外,圆形符号还可以用于表示弱实体,即依赖于其他实体存在的实体。
四、圆形符号在数据流图(DFD)中的应用
数据流图(DFD)是另一种常用的数据库设计工具,用于表示系统中的数据流动和处理过程。在DFD中,圆形符号常用于表示数据存储位置,如文件、数据库表等。圆形符号的使用,使得数据存储位置在图中非常直观易识别,有助于设计师和开发者理解系统的数据流动和处理过程。此外,圆形符号还可以用于表示数据处理过程,即系统中数据的输入、处理和输出。
五、圆形符号在其他数据库设计工具中的应用
除了ER图和DFD,圆形符号还被广泛应用于其他数据库设计工具和方法中。在统一建模语言(UML)中,圆形符号用于表示类图中的对象和属性。在关系数据库设计工具中,圆形符号用于表示表中的字段和记录。这些设计工具和方法的广泛使用,使圆形符号成为数据库设计中的标准符号之一。
六、圆形符号的心理学意义
从心理学的角度来看,圆形符号具有特殊的意义。圆形通常被认为是完美、和谐和统一的象征。在数据库设计中,使用圆形符号可以传达数据存储和处理的完整性和一致性。此外,圆形符号没有尖锐的边角,看起来更加友好和平易近人,有助于用户减少认知负担,更加专注于数据结构和关系的理解。
七、圆形符号的设计和视觉效果
在设计和视觉效果方面,圆形符号具有独特的优势。圆形符号的对称性和简洁性,使其在设计图中非常醒目易识别。设计师可以通过不同的颜色、大小和线条粗细来区分不同类型的圆形符号,从而增强设计图的可读性和美观性。此外,圆形符号在不同尺寸和分辨率下都能保持良好的视觉效果,适应各种显示设备和打印介质。
八、圆形符号的现代应用和发展趋势
随着数据库技术的不断发展,圆形符号的应用也在不断演变和扩展。在大数据和云计算环境中,圆形符号仍然是表示数据存储和处理的常用符号。例如,在云数据库设计中,圆形符号可以用来表示云存储位置和数据处理节点。此外,圆形符号还被广泛应用于数据可视化工具中,如数据图表和仪表盘等,用于表示数据点、数据集和数据关系。随着数据库技术的不断创新,圆形符号的应用将更加多样化和智能化。
九、圆形符号在不同文化和语言中的应用
圆形符号不仅在技术领域有广泛应用,在不同文化和语言中也具有重要意义。在东方文化中,圆形象征着和谐、完美和循环,这与数据库设计中数据的完整性和一致性理念相契合。在西方文化中,圆形常用于表示循环和连续性,这也与数据库中数据流动和处理的概念相符。因此,圆形符号在全球范围内都具有广泛的接受度和适用性,成为数据库设计中的通用符号。
十、圆形符号的未来发展方向
随着科技的不断进步,圆形符号在数据库设计中的应用也将不断发展。未来,圆形符号可能会与人工智能和机器学习技术相结合,用于智能化的数据分析和处理。例如,通过智能算法,圆形符号可以动态调整其大小、颜色和位置,以更直观地展示数据变化和关系。此外,虚拟现实(VR)和增强现实(AR)技术的发展,也为圆形符号在三维空间中的应用提供了新的可能。设计师可以通过VR/AR技术,更直观地展示和操作数据库设计图,提升设计效率和效果。
十一、圆形符号在教育和培训中的应用
在数据库教育和培训中,圆形符号的应用也非常广泛。圆形符号因其直观易懂的特点,非常适合用于教学和培训材料中。教师可以通过圆形符号,直观地向学生展示数据库结构和数据关系,帮助学生更好地理解和掌握数据库设计知识。此外,圆形符号还可以用于在线课程和培训视频中,增强学习体验和效果。
十二、圆形符号在实际项目中的应用案例
在实际项目中,圆形符号的应用案例非常多。例如,在某大型电商平台的数据库设计中,设计师使用圆形符号表示商品、用户、订单等实体的属性和关系,通过直观的ER图展示数据库结构和数据流动,极大地提高了设计效率和系统性能。在某金融机构的数据分析项目中,圆形符号被用于表示客户信息、交易记录和风险评估数据,通过直观的数据流图展示数据处理过程,帮助分析师快速理解和处理数据。
十三、圆形符号与其他图形符号的比较
在数据库设计中,除了圆形符号,还有其他图形符号如矩形、菱形、三角形等。圆形符号与其他图形符号相比,具有独特的优势。例如,圆形符号的对称性和无方向性,使其在表示数据存储和处理时更加直观和易于理解。而矩形符号和菱形符号,虽然在表示实体和关系时也有一定的优势,但在直观性和易理解性方面略逊于圆形符号。因此,圆形符号在数据库设计中仍然是最常用和最受欢迎的符号之一。
十四、圆形符号的标准化和规范化
为了提高数据库设计的统一性和规范性,国际标准化组织(ISO)和其他相关机构制定了一系列标准和规范,明确规定了圆形符号在数据库设计中的使用方法和规则。这些标准和规范包括符号的形状、大小、颜色、线条粗细等方面的要求,确保设计图的一致性和可读性。通过遵循这些标准和规范,设计师可以更高效地进行数据库设计,确保系统的稳定性和可靠性。
十五、圆形符号的创新应用
在现代数据库设计中,圆形符号的创新应用也不断涌现。例如,在某智能城市项目中,设计师使用圆形符号表示城市中的各类数据节点,如交通、能源、环境等,通过智能化的数据分析和处理,实现城市的智能管理和优化。在某医疗数据管理系统中,圆形符号被用于表示患者信息、医疗记录和诊断数据,通过直观的数据流图展示医疗数据的处理过程,提升医疗服务质量和效率。
综上所述,数据库符号用圆表示的原因在于其直观性、易理解性、历史传统和广泛应用等方面的优势。圆形符号的使用,不仅提高了数据库设计的效率和效果,还在现代数据库技术的发展中发挥着重要作用。通过不断创新和优化,圆形符号在数据库设计中的应用将更加多样化和智能化,为数据库技术的发展贡献力量。
相关问答FAQs:
为什么数据库符号用圆表示?
数据库设计中,使用圆形符号的原因可以追溯到实体-关系模型(ER模型)的基本原则。圆形符号通常用来表示实体,这种图形的选择不仅具有视觉美感,还能有效传达信息。
圆形符号的使用源自于几种关键考虑。首先,圆形是一个对称的形状,能够在视觉上提供平衡感。它代表着一种完整性,符合实体的定义,即一个独立的对象或概念。在数据库设计中,实体是数据库中存储的信息的基础,使用圆形能够让设计者和用户更容易理解和识别这些重要的组成部分。
其次,圆形符号的使用还体现了数据的流动性。数据库通常是动态的,数据在其中不断变化和移动。圆形的形状暗示了这种流动性和变化,使得设计图在视觉上更具活力。
再者,圆形符号在图形化表示中有助于避免混淆。与其他形状(如方形或三角形)相比,圆形通常不会与其他图形类型混淆,能够清晰地传达出其代表的含义。这种清晰性在复杂数据库设计中尤为重要,能够让设计者和开发者更快地理解和交流。
圆形在数据库设计中的其他用途是什么?
圆形符号在数据库设计中的用途并不局限于实体表示。它们还可以用于表示其他概念,如关系、约束和属性等。在一些情况下,圆形符号可以与其他图形相结合,以形成更复杂的模型。
在ER图中,圆形可以用于表示属性,通常与连接线结合使用。通过这种方式,设计者能够清晰地展示一个实体的特征,同时也能指示出不同属性之间的关系。这种视觉化的方法使得复杂的数据库结构更容易理解。
另外,圆形符号还可以用于表示聚合或组合关系。在某些情况下,多个实体可以组合在一起,形成一个新的实体。使用圆形符号可以有效地展示这种关系,使得设计图更具可读性。
使用圆形符号的历史背景是什么?
圆形符号的使用并不是偶然,它有着深厚的历史背景。早期的数据库设计主要受到数学和逻辑学的影响。随着数据库技术的发展,设计师们逐渐意识到图形表示的重要性。实体-关系模型的提出,标志着数据库设计进入了一个新的阶段。
在这一过程中,图形化表示成为了数据库设计的核心部分。设计者开始探索各种形状在数据库图中的应用,最终圆形因其独特的视觉效果和传达能力而被广泛采用。随着时间的推移,这一标准逐渐被各大数据库管理系统所接受,并成为数据库设计的通用语言。
在现代数据库设计中,圆形符号已经成为了不可或缺的元素。无论是学术研究还是实际应用,设计者们都在不断探索和完善这种符号的使用,使其在不同的情境中发挥更大的作用。
如何有效使用圆形符号进行数据库设计?
在进行数据库设计时,合理使用圆形符号可以极大地提升设计的清晰度和有效性。设计者应该考虑以下几个方面:
首先,确保每个实体都被清晰地表示为一个圆形。在设计图中,保持一致的比例和位置能够帮助阅读者快速识别和理解各个实体。避免在设计图中使用过多的圆形符号,以免造成视觉上的混乱。
其次,使用连接线清晰地展示实体之间的关系。通过不同类型的连接线(如实线、虚线等),设计者可以传达不同的关系类型(如一对一、一对多等),使得设计图更具层次感。这种方法能够帮助设计者和开发者更好地理解数据之间的相互作用。
在表示属性时,可以考虑使用圆形附加在实体圆形的旁边。通过这种方式,设计者能够有效地展示属性与实体之间的关系,使得设计图更具结构性。
最后,建议在设计图中使用不同的颜色来区分不同的实体和关系。颜色能够增强视觉效果,使得复杂的设计图更加易于理解。此外,设计者还可以在圆形内部添加文本标签,进一步提升信息的传达效果。
总结:圆形符号在数据库设计中的重要性
圆形符号在数据库设计中具有重要的象征意义和实用价值。通过对圆形符号的有效使用,设计者能够提升数据库设计的清晰度和可读性,帮助团队成员更好地理解和交流设计理念。
选择使用圆形符号并非偶然,这一设计选择基于其对称性、完整性和流动性等特征。随着数据库技术的发展,圆形符号的使用已成为一种标准,反映了数据库设计领域的演变与进步。
通过深入理解圆形符号在数据库设计中的应用,设计者可以在实际工作中更好地利用这一工具,提高数据库设计的效率和质量。
本文内容通过AI工具匹配关键字智能整合而成,仅供参考,帆软不对内容的真实、准确或完整作任何形式的承诺。具体产品功能请以帆软官方帮助文档为准,或联系您的对接销售进行咨询。如有其他问题,您可以通过联系blog@fanruan.com进行反馈,帆软收到您的反馈后将及时答复和处理。